HINTON W.Va. (Hinton News) – The Summers County Public Library was recently taken over by West Virginia’s infamous winged monster Mothman. Library employee Weston Hartwell planned a fun-filled evening for the event goers with all activities revolving around West Virginia’s winged menace of cryptic fame.
There were small 3D-printed Mothman figures, bracelets and stickers for attendees. The library was decorated with books about Mothman and a documentary about the menacing creature was being shown upstairs. Hartwell led a round of Mothman trivia with amazing prizes being given out for first, second and third place, plus a door prize was given out. Botany Tropicals was on site with amazing Mothman merchandise and also provided a couple of prizes.
The entire library staff was in incredible Mothman shirts. One of those fantastic shirts was also one of the night’s prizes.
Felisha Hartwell provided pepperoni rolls and the library had smores, punch, bottled water and cheese skewers for snacks.
There was a lot of laughter, and mingling among everyone, overall lots of enjoyment.
The night was a success and the community– can’t wait to see what event is next.
